Job description

Automation Engineer - Offshore Operations

Talos Energy is a leading energy company focused on offshore oil and gas exploration and production as well as the development of future carbon capture and storage opportunities in the United States Gulf Coast, Gulf of America and offshore Mexico. We provide safe, reliable and responsible energy production that powers our world and delivers energy prosperity to modern life, while simultaneously applying core skill sets to develop large-scale decarbonization projects to reduce industrial emissions. Locations for this role could be in Houston, TX or Lafayette, LA.

D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ES:

The Automation Engineer provides asset-aligned Automation support for offshore Operations, including troubleshooting, MOC support, PLC/HMI/SCADA support, project and commissioning support, vendor coordination, standards adherence, documentation quality, and control system reliability improvement. This role serves as the primary Automation focal point for assigned assets and works closely with Operations, I&E, Facility Engineering, IT, OT Systems, Data/Historian, vendors, and integrators to safely support and improve offshore production systems.

  • Serve as the primary Automation focal point for assigned offshore assets and maintain awareness of asset-specific PLCs, HMIs, SCADA systems, historian interfaces, control networks, alarm/shutdown logic, vendor packages, and support needs.
  • Assist field personnel and Operations in troubleshooting issues and provide clear direction for remediation during daily support, offshore execution, after-hours events, and time-sensitive operational issues.
  • Lead structured troubleshooting for PLC, HMI, SCADA, communications, instrumentation interface, alarm, shutdown, package equipment, and historian data issues. Differentiate between instrumentation, logic, HMI display, network, historian, vendor package, and process-related issues.
  • Support common communications protocols including Ethernet I/P, Modbus, ControlNet, HART, and OPC.
  • Review MOCs for Automation, I&E, controls, alarms, shutdown logic, historian, HMI, cybersecurity, networking, and commissioning impacts. Identify hidden Automation/I&E scope early in Facilities, Subsea, Operations, and maintenance-driven changes.
  • Support MOC and project closeout by verifying drawings, logic backups, HMI backups, configuration records, redlines, test records, and final documentation are updated and complete.
  • Source, select, and manage vendors in the operational technology (OT), automation, and system integration space. Set clear scope, specification, schedule, documentation, testing, and closeout expectations with vendors and integrators.
  • Participate in project lifecycle activities including project definition, FEED and design basis, concept selection, material specification, engineering, implementation, validation and testing, FAT/SAT, installation, commissioning, startup, maintenance, and closeout.
  • Coordinate with OT Systems & Cybersecurity on OT networks, servers, VMware environments, backups, patching, remote access, cyber remediation, and recovery needs for assigned assets.
  • Coordinate with OT Historian & Data Reliability on historian tag issues, PI/OPC interfaces, stale or bad data, data quality concerns, operational context, and sensor gaps for optimization or AI readiness.
  • Coordinate with Automation Project Engineering on Facilities projects, TARs, project intake, FAT/SAT expectations, commissioning readiness, technical standards, and integrator execution.
  • Document root cause, corrective action, and follow-up actions after significant failures, recurring issues, or events affecting safety, production, reliability, cybersecurity, or data quality.

EDUCATION & EXPERIENCE:
  • Bachelor’s degree in mechanical engineering, electrical engineering, industrial technology, automation, computer engineering, or related technical field.
  • 5+ years of automation, controls, SCADA, or OT experience in oil & gas, industrial operations, manufacturing, or process control environments. Offshore oil & gas experience strongly preferred.
  • Experience supporting live production assets with PLC, HMI, SCADA, historian, instrumentation, and vendor package interfaces.
  • Familiar with the principles of offshore production automation, including process control, safety systems, fire & gas systems, shutdown logic, and emergency shutdown (ESD) systems.
  • Ability to read, troubleshoot, and develop common PLC logic and HMI/SCADA displays.
  • Familiar with offshore control room HMI/SCADA design, historian architectures, alarm management, and control room usability concepts.
  • Familiar with networking, process control and business network segregation, remote access, and OT cybersecurity expectations.

PREFERRED TECHNICAL EXPERIENCE:
  • Rockwell / Allen-Bradley ControlLogix, CompactLogix, Studio 5000, FactoryTalk View, PanelView, or related platforms.
  • Emerson DeltaV, Ignition, Wonderware / AVEVA, OSIsoft / AVEVA PI, OPC, Kepware, or similar SCADA/HMI/historian platforms.
  • Industrial Ethernet, managed switches, firewalls, VLANs, remote access, and basic control system network troubleshooting.
  • Windows Server, VMware, backup systems, domain services, engineering workstations, and virtualized OT environments.
  • Fire & Gas, ESD, safety system interfaces, package controls, flow computers, and measurement systems.
